Callma Vinum operates in Casablanca Valley, the cool-climate pocket of Chile's Aconcagua region. The valley's maritime influence and diurnal temperature swings favor wines of precision and structure. The winery's portfolio centers on three flagship expressions: Veneris Pinot Noir, a silky expression of the variety's elegance; Mercurii Merlot, built on the grape's ripe fruit and textural depth; and Jovis Malbec, showcasing the varietal's dark fruit intensity and tannin architecture. Each has earned recognition from Wine Advocate, reflecting the technical caliber of the winemaking. Casablanca's reputation for Pinot Noir and cool-climate reds aligns with the character these wines display—wines marked by balance and definition rather than extraction.
